In this week’s episode, I’m joined by special guest Jayne Havens to talk about how she’s grown her sleep coaching business to 6-figures and the chances she had to take (while facing criticism from others along the way).
 
We chatted about:
 
How Jayne became the provider for her family and the challenges she faced along the way How to push fear to the back burner so you can take more risks  How to keep going and have that confidence in yourself to pave the way despite not feeling fully supported by the people in your life  
About Jayne:
 
Jayne’s journey began when she was overwhelmed as a new parent, struggling to understand why her son was awake throughout the night. Desperate for answers, she diligently researched sleep strategies. Over time, Jayne applied what she learned, first to her son, and then a few years later, to her daughter. She successfully helped her kids establish good sleep habits very early on – something that didn’t go unnoticed by her friends with children of their own. Word of Jayne’s sleep expertise spread quickly, and she soon found that her guidance was in high demand. She formed Snooze Fest in order to coach and support parents across the country to achieve better sleep for their little ones. Jayne quickly established herself as a leader in the industry, building a strong reputation for both her extensive knowledge and her extraordinary client service. She describes her approach as “client-led,” meaning she coaches families using methods that align with their parenting style and that feel safe and comfortable for them. Jayne believes there is no one-size-fits-all approach when it comes to teaching a child to fall asleep and back to sleep independently. In addition to supporting families through the sleep training process, Jayne also founded Center for Pediatric Sleep Management. Through CPSM, Jayne trains, mentors and certifies others to do this incredibly rewarding work.
